    • Our Lady of Mercy Catholic Church

    • Our Lady of Mercy Catholic Church

    • Our Lady of Mercy Catholic Church (Ybor City, Fla.) -- Photographs; Churches -- Florida -- Ybor City -- Photographs

    • Our Lady of Mercy Catholic Church in the 1890s. It was built February 20, 1891 and services ended on January 26, 1937. It was located on the northeast corner of 10th Avenue and 17th Street.

    • Demosthenic Demonstrator

    • Demosthenic Demonstrator

    • Rollins College (Winter Park, Fla.) -- 1890 - 1900

    • In June, 1894, the Demosthenic Demonstrator was published in the form of an early Sandspur, combining social elements with literature. The Sandpur was not published until December 20, 1894, as an annual.
